On Thursday, Dr. Rob Jackson completed his eighth full-day school visit; he spent the day at Owen Middle School. Owen is located in the beautiful Swannanoa Valley. The school was founded in 1991 with the consolidation of Black Mountain Middle School and Swannanoa Middle School. The school currently serves about 419 students with 76 staff members. OMS proudly wears maroon and gray and is the Home of the Warcolts.

Students may participate in a variety of clubs including E-Sports, Community Club, Dungeons and Dragons, Student Government, Soccer Club, Frisbee Golf Club, and Battle of the Books. Also, middle school opens doors for students to explore world languages, dive into robotics and medicine with Project Lead the Way Classes, and participate in a variety of athletics!
